/**
|
|
* MessageCodec using the Flutter standard binary encoding.
|
|
*
|
|
* <p>This codec is guaranteed to be compatible with the corresponding
|
|
* <a href="https://docs.flutter.io/flutter/services/StandardMessageCodec-class.html">StandardMessageCodec</a>
|
|
* on the Dart side. These parts of the Flutter SDK are evolved synchronously.</p>
|
|
*
|
|
* <p>Supported messages are acyclic values of these forms:</p>
|
|
*
|
|
* <ul>
|
|
* <li>null</li>
|
|
* <li>Booleans</li>
|
|
* <li>Bytes, Shorts, Integers, Longs</li>
|
|
* <li>BigIntegers (see below)</li>
|
|
* <li>Floats, Doubles</li>
|
|
* <li>Strings</li>
|
|
* <li>byte[], int[], long[], double[]</li>
|
|
* <li>Lists of supported values</li>
|
|
* <li>Maps with supported keys and values</li>
|
|
* </ul>
|
|
*
|
|
* <p>On the Dart side, these values are represented as follows:</p>
|
|
*
|
|
* <ul>
|
|
* <li>null: null</li>
|
|
* <li>Boolean: bool</li>
|
|
* <li>Byte, Short, Integer, Long: int</li>
|
|
* <li>Float, Double: double</li>
|
|
* <li>String: String</li>
|
|
* <li>byte[]: Uint8List</li>
|
|
* <li>int[]: Int32List</li>
|
|
* <li>long[]: Int64List</li>
|
|
* <li>double[]: Float64List</li>
|
|
* <li>List: List</li>
|
|
* <li>Map: Map</li>
|
|
* </ul>
|
|
*
|
|
* <p>BigIntegers are represented in Dart as strings with the
|
|
* hexadecimal representation of the integer's value.</p>
|
|
*
|
|
* <p>To extend the codec, overwrite the writeValue and readValueOfType methods.</p>
|
|
*/
